Subject: Update on School Safety and Operations
Dear Parents/Guardians,
I hope this message finds you well. I am writing to provide you with an important update regarding the safety of our school environment.
Recently, there was a situation involving a staff member who left for medical treatment and was found with elevated CO levels. As soon as this was brought to our attention, we took immediate action to thoroughly investigate all of the school premises, working closely with professionals, including the Alma Fire Department.
I am pleased to inform you that after a comprehensive assessment, only trace amounts of CO were detected, well below what is considered normal for a well-ventilated home. Furthermore, we have CO monitors installed throughout the building, which will undergo regular checks and, if necessary, replacements to ensure continuous monitoring.
Please rest assured that the safety and well-being of our students and staff are of utmost importance to us. With the confirmation from the authorities and our proactive measures in place, I want to assure you that the school has been deemed safe for regular operations tomorrow.
Your trust in our school community is deeply valued, and we want to assure you that we are committed to maintaining a safe and nurturing environment for your children.
Should you have any questions or concerns, please do not hesitate to contact us. We appreciate your understanding and support as we prioritize the safety of our school community.
